From ec2d1a1291f17fc66e1d1b0eedad4ff2ecee827a Mon Sep 17 00:00:00 2001 From: ggman12 Date: Wed, 18 Feb 2026 21:08:07 -0500 Subject: [PATCH] update download.sh --- scripts/download.sh | 6 ++++++ 1 file changed, 6 insertions(+) diff --git a/scripts/download.sh b/scripts/download.sh index 1817ae0..27bf165 100644 --- a/scripts/download.sh +++ b/scripts/download.sh @@ -23,6 +23,12 @@ gh run list \ "repos/$REPO/actions/runs/$run_id/artifacts" \ --jq '.artifacts[] | select(.name | test("^openairframes_adsb-[0-9]{4}-[0-9]{2}-[0-9]{2}-[0-9]{4}-[0-9]{2}-[0-9]{2}$")) | .name' | while read -r artifact_name; do + # Check if artifact directory already exists and has files + if [ -d "downloads/adsb_artifacts/$artifact_name" ] && [ -n "$(ls -A "downloads/adsb_artifacts/$artifact_name" 2>/dev/null)" ]; then + echo " Skipping (already exists): $artifact_name" + continue + fi + echo " Downloading: $artifact_name" gh run download "$run_id" \ --repo "$REPO" \